What is CVE-2025-15582?
A security flaw in the detronetdip E-commerce version 1.0.0 has been identified, specifically in the Product Management Module's Delete/Update function. This vulnerability allows for an authorization bypass through manipulation of the argument ID, enabling potential unauthorized access to sensitive operations. With the exploit now public, attackers could exploit this flaw remotely. Despite being alerted to the issue, there has been no response from the project team. Users are advised to review their security measures and seek immediate remediation.
